你查询的IP:[168.160.73.5]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询60.55.253.82 118.64.62.30 210.22.11.77 60.160.122.3 210.72.74.50 121.89.67.10 218.96.75.98 58.32.174.66 218.45.100.9 168.160.73.5 202.38.164.210 203.207.64.96 117.122.128.236 119.42.136.244 58.192.19.131 120.24.84.76 210.32.170.16 202.179.240.231 119.96.135.121 116.16.89.207 202.4.128.113 118.224.128.194 202.127.40.47 120.64.114.19 192.124.154.3 119.10.55.99 220.248.203.144 203.88.192.188 58.32.41.187 202.149.160.96 59.172.53.17